The compact harvester’s core is the UT110evo
tracked vehicle, which is light and small enough to be transported on a tractor trailer. On arrival, a side ramp on the trailer folds out, and the vehicle drives down and into the vineyard row. A winch connects the vehicle to the trailer and supports it with a tractive force of 1.5 tonnes, which allows gradients of up to 75% to be climbed. In these steep locations, the operator can incline their seat. The engineers specified energy chains made of high-performance plastic from igus to guide the hydraulic and electrical cables from the vehicle to the harvesting head. The e-chains not only prevent the cables from kinking and jamming but also eliminate the risk of them getting caught in the vines. In addition, the energy chains are made of durable, corrosion-free, UV-resistant high- performance plastic, meaning that they retain their mechanical properties for years without maintenance. Classic metal bearings have also been replaced with igus polymer bearings, which are corrosion-free, robust and require no added lubrication, as solid lubricants already integrated in the material enable low-friction dry running. can be connected to the front-loading area of the tracked vehicle in 30 minutes using just six screws. This has two movable arms, connected to the upper part of the machine enclosing the vine. On the insides of these arms is a mechanism that vibrates the vine with up to 620 vibrations per minute, shaking off the grapes. A collection system under the machine collects the grapes and transports them to a collection container. The harvester moves down the vineyard at a speed of up to 2.8 miles per hour and, on the way back, is capable of reaching speeds of up to 5.6 miles per hour, pulled by the winch. Back on the trailer, operators empty the container and position the vehicle for the next row of vines until the entire vineyard has been harvested.
